    WL-138 confusion

    Hoping for some enlightenment over WL-138s. I want to buy some the same as in a new Dell Vista machine we have here as it gives excellent reception, (unlike some other cards here!).

    The Dell card shows as a "Broadcom 802.11G" device in device mgr and it has both "WL-138G V2 R3.01" AND "WL-138gE R1.41" printed on it.

    This confuses me as the cards I see on the ASUS site are either 138G V2 OR 138gE. Our Internet stores show them separately as well (the gE is dearer).

    I also tried the card in an XP machine and downloaded a gE dvr for it. It performed extremely well.

    Is the Dell card a dual one? Will I see a difference between a G V2 and a gE working to a WAG200G? Should I get the dearer ($NZ40 v $NZ30) gE?
